天河12345 发表于 2013-7-23 09:41 
版主帮帮忙了,ad口是有两个。但是采集信号的时候,用一路采集,还是两路采集,算压差? ...
不好意思前天你回复我没看到,我记错了,是3个AD,但只有2个支持DMA。 像楼主这么接入AD我觉得可能会损坏AD,因为一旦外部输出电压不稳定,超过3.3V的话,你AD就报废了。所以建议在输入AD前加上运放跟随,至于用1个还是2个采集的问题,其实就是单端输入跟差分输入的问题,我没试过STM32的AD差分输入,但我看手册上他没有差分输入功能,也就说即便你使用两个AD采,跟一个AD采结果是差不多的,还不如在AD前加一个差分运放来抑制共模噪声比较好。
|